The Big Fraud Committed By INEC To Rig Anambra Election…APGA Candidate Actually Polled 91,740

Fejiro Oliver

While Nigerians especially Anambra voters await November 30th to go to the poll and vote in their choice candidate for the supplementary election, our reporters in her analytical newsroom has uncovered the hidden scores behind the election that was held on November 16th.

Our reporters who monitored the election reported rigging in many polling votes visited, with the ruling All Progressive Grand Alliance (APGA) sharing N10,000 to voters to cast the vote. Unsure of how the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) came about the votes allocated by voters, we discovered a big fraud mathematically and statistically.

According to INEC, out of the 1,763,751 voters registered for the election, only 451,826 were accredited. Total valid votes stood at 413,005, while the invalid ones were 16,544. Total votes cast were 429,549, while 113,113 votes were nullified or cancelled as INEC used the term. This was where our reporters acting on intelligence scoop found the rigging blunder. With those number of votes cancelled, the State had only 316, 436 valid votes casted.

The electoral body told the world that the candidates scored the following votes, which were written against their names.

Mr.Willie Obiano of APGA got 174,710 to finish tops

Mr. Tony Nwoye of PDP polled 94,956 to finish runner up

Mr. Chris Ngige of APC was third with 92,300 votes

Mr. Ifeanyi Ubah of LP came fourth with 37,440
The amazing results totaled 399,406 which were cast during the election, which we gathered is NOT possible under any calculation in statistics or mathematics, bearing in mind that INEC declared 429,529 votes casted, out of which 113,113 were nullified, with only 316,416 legitimate votes casted.

This calculation by our reporters render the election invalid and we can report with all authority that the election was rigged, as the votes allocated to the candidates do not reflect the actual numbers of voters who voted. The vote given to the candidates by INEC is higher than the number of votes casted. 82970 votes as we have always maintained were added to the votes of the APGA candidate, Willie Obaino, thus making the election a scam and a sham.

An addition of the votes ‘scored’ by the candidate and the invalid votes brings a total 512,519 voters, thereby rendering the 429,529 votes casted as announced by INEC fraudulent, with same wide margin of 82,970 ghost voters added. With the removal of the ghost voters allocated to the APGA candidate, he has a legitimate vote of 91,740.

Re: Inec Scam Against Anambra State Gov Election by sholatech(m): 12:33am On Nov 25, 2013
It is better the researcher or reporter remove the words 'mathematically' and 'statistically' because it already made a weird assumption that his 'assumed differential' should be deducted ONLY from a single candidate. That singular assumption makes his assertion non-empirical and thus will not hold ground. Reeks strictly of bias
